Transaction 63e391ddcc589b575de7de636566c0d4834109b3bde207dc38877bc2c16faee8
1 Input
1 Output
-
63e391ddcc589b575de7de636566c0d4834109b3bde207dc38877bc2c16faee8:0
- value
- 610658
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12f81ed0fe827bd1b27ba6acee77f5929a7e032c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12jJQADfuRqVbp5t9zKp29rbfXXe9VMm77